How to fill out construction storm water management

01
Step 1: Start by gathering all the necessary information and documentation related to the construction project.
02
Step 2: Assess the site for potential sources of stormwater runoff and pollution.
03
Step 3: Develop a stormwater management plan that includes control measures and best management practices.
04
Step 4: Implement the stormwater management plan by installing appropriate erosion controls, sediment traps, and drainage systems.
05
Step 5: Regularly inspect and maintain all stormwater management infrastructure to ensure its effectiveness.
06
Step 6: Monitor and test the quality of stormwater runoff to ensure compliance with regulations and guidelines.
07
Step 7: Keep records of all stormwater management activities and submit necessary reports to regulatory agencies.
08
Step 8: Continuously review and update the stormwater management plan as the construction project progresses.
09
Step 9: Train construction personnel on proper stormwater management practices and educate them about the importance of pollution prevention.

Construction storm water management is the practice of controlling and treating storm water runoff from construction sites to protect water quality and prevent pollution.
Any entity conducting construction activities that disturb one or more acres of land is required to file construction storm water management.
Construction storm water management can be filled out by providing information on erosion and sediment control measures, storm water management practices, and monitoring and reporting requirements.
The purpose of construction storm water management is to minimize the impact of construction activities on water quality and the environment by controlling and treating storm water runoff.
Information such as project details, erosion control practices, storm water management plans, and monitoring data must be reported on construction storm water management.
